Coming Home

Have you ever been away for a long period time, away from everything familiar?

It’s exciting at first; everything is new… You see things you’ve never seen before, maybe you hear languages you’ve never heard before…

The people dress differently, the food is all new to you and you want to remember every little detail.  In the course of all this excitement, you also feel a little uneasy because there is little that seems “normal” and the excitement slowly turns to general unease.  Then the unease turns slowly into fatigue, and fatigue slowly turns into a desire to go home.

When you finally return to familiar territory and home, everything is right again.  In my case, returning home always gives me a much greater appreciation of everything that I usually take for granted.  Of course, that is not necessarily to say that I didn’t enjoy travelling, but there’s just something about going home…

Sometimes we stray from our walk with our Lord.  It might seem exciting at first, but that usually wears off until we are just ill at ease and fatigued…  Isn’t it great to return home where we belong?
